Got all the way to flowering. And I'm noticing drooping, burnt tips, yellowing on one white widow and dark green and slight leaf curling on one wedding cake. My initial thought is nute toxcity and possibly over watering? I water about once a week. I pH the run-off after each watering and getting around 6. Both plants were thrown into flowering...maybe 4-5 weeks ago. I've switched them over to bloom formula per the fox farms guide.
Grow Info:
Indoor microgrow.
Coir and perilite grow medium
LED bulbs
Foxfarms liquid fertilizer
Water with Reverse Osmosis water, cal-mag added.
Temps are kept at about 80 F and 35-40% humidity.
I don't understand how it could be nute burn as I cut the recommended amounts down to half and water with pure RO between every feeding. Can I get a more experienced growers opinion? Any other critiques are welcome. It's my very first grow and I'm sure I missed something.
